The schepencollege decided Monday afternoon that the outdoor swimming pool is definitively the doors close. ‘The dock’, as the zwemdok popularly called, was a heated outdoor swimming pool. Since 1888 could swimmers go for a swim. Last year was the 130th anniversary of the pool was celebrated with lots of activities. However, there were already a few years dark storm clouds above the pool. A summer like in 2018 may still be profitable, but usually they turned the pool loss.
